中文摘要: 西藏某斑岩型铜矿石中Cu、Mo品位分别为0.73%、0.044%,主要可回收金属矿物为辉铜矿、黄铜矿和辉钼矿,脉石矿物主要为石英、方解石、石榴子石等,随着矿产资源的不断开采和岩层分布变化,矿石种类日益繁多,矿物间交代嵌布关系复杂,采用原有的选矿工艺难以获得较好的选矿指标,为有效回收矿石中的铜和钼,针对原矿性质,采用混合浮选工艺开展浮选试验。通过条件试验确定适宜的磨矿细度-0.074mm占65%,等可浮粗选捕收剂BK404C和BK345总用量为32g/t,强化粗选捕收剂BK404B和BK404C总用量为28g/t,石灰用量2000g/t。在此基础上,采用“一次等可浮粗选,一次等可浮精选,一次强化粗选,两次强化精选,两次扫选”的闭路浮选工艺流程,最终可获得Cu品位23.27%、Cu回收率87.14%、Mo品位1.34%、Mo回收率82.24%的铜钼混合精矿,较好地实现了斑岩型铜矿石中有价金属的综合回收。

Abstract:The Cu and Mo grades of a porphyry copper ore in Xizang Province are 0.73% and 0.044% respectively. The main recyclable metal minerals are chene, chalcopyrite and molybdenite, while gangue minerals are mainly quartz, calcite and garnet. With the continuous exploitation of mineral resources and the change of rock strata distribution, the ore types are increasingly diverse, and the metasomatic and interlaying relations between minerals are complex. In order to recover copper and molybdenum from ore effectively, flotation tests were carried out by mixed flotation process according to the properties of raw ore. The optimum grinding fineness of -0.074mm accounted for 65%, the total amount of equal floating collector BK404C and BK345 was 32g/t, the total amount of enhanced coarse collector BK404B and BK404C was 28g/t, and the amount of lime was 2000g/t. On this basis, the closed-circuit flotation process of "once floatable roughing, once floatable cleaning, once strengthened roughing, twice strengthened cleaning, twice swept cleaning" is adopted to obtain a copper-molybdenum mixed concentrate with Cu grade of 23.27%, Cu recovery rate of 87.14%, Mo grade of 1.34% and Mo recovery rate of 82.24%. The comprehensive recovery of valuable metals from porphyry copper ore is realized.
